In 1996, Nest Ranch was moved by the District to the GVRD (currently called City Vancouver) to be managed as a regional park. Metro Vancouver handles the park in conformity with the Nest Farm Land Use Plan which marks particular areas for farming, wild animals and incorporated monitoring. The park protects a variety of environment kinds consisting of the biggest old-field environment in the North-East field.


Throughout the cold weather great deals of Great Blue Herons, a species at risk, forage in the fields at Colony Farm. By late March, these herons initiate nesting in a heronry at the confluence of the Coquitlam and Fraser River, which has been protected as a Wildlife Management Area since 1994.

From a web site that is made for a heritage celebration that happens in my community, I found out a great deal concerning the history of the French-Canadian negotiation in Maillardville.


The French-Canadian settlers came right here in the loss of 1909. There was a group of 110 French Canadians that moved here from Ontario and Quebec. They traveled to Fraser Mills by railway with the purpose of helping Fraser Mills as millworkers. The proprietors of Fraser Mills enticed individuals ahead by providing accessibility to land, timber, houses, cultural conservation and liberty.


There was a great deal of lumber which was a great and essential resource - coquitlam bc weather. The celebration that commemorates the background of the town's formation and french culture is called festival du bois which equates to celebration of wood to honor the initial lumber employees and sector that started the community

By 1910, Our Woman of Lourdes church was constructed, making it among the initial structures in the area. 2 years later on, in 1912, the area would certainly be called after its initial clergyman, R.P. Edmond Maillard o. m.i., that played a prominent role in the community. Quickly, the initial shops would certainly quickly open up along Pitt River Roadway (which would later end up being Brunette Avenue), including the Proulx basic shop.
